titleOfInvention Titanium oxide dispersion and method for producing the same
abstract PROBLEM TO BE SOLVED: To provide a titanium oxide dispersion which can be uniformly dispersed even when a high-purity titanium oxide powder is added at a high concentration, has a low viscosity and has a neutral pH range, and a method for producing the same. SOLUTION: A titanium oxide dispersion precursor comprising a titanium oxide powder, one or more dispersants selected from amine-based dispersants and / or carboxyl group-containing polymer dispersants, and an aqueous solvent or an organic solvent. A titanium oxide dispersion obtained by subjecting a body to wet crushing treatment, and a method for producing a titanium oxide dispersion comprising subjecting the titanium oxide dispersion precursor to wet crushing treatment.
